How they compare
Spain currently reports 12,468 Thousand persons against 5,128 Thousand persons in Romania, a difference of 7,340 Thousand persons.
That makes Spain's figure about 2.4 times Romania's.
Across all 11 years both countries report, Spain has been ahead every year.
Romania ranks 6th and Spain ranks 5th of 43 countries.
Spain has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
